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43309 550 536776 8411
1656 89
1656 89
7402174 586327635 034729
All about undefined
Interested in learning more?
1656 89
7402174 586327635 034729
See more
93546867 725 3633
43088 92628 7141804 87946305585
See more
86734939 28
176 71199079 41
See more